Indian Restaurants in Maynard, Massachusetts (MA) With Map View


Loading...Please wait...

** Please verify the address and other information before you make the trip. We are not responsible for any inconveniences.

+ Add new Indian Restaurants to our listing

Monsoon Indian Bistro (Nearby Indian Restaurants)
155 Main St
Maynard, Massachusetts - 01754
Phone: (978) 897 9227

Updated on Nov, 2024


 
     
{{item.Name}} ({{item.Distance}} Miles *)
{{item.Address}}
Tags: Indian Restaurants in Maynard Massachusetts (MA) With Map View Indian Restaurants in Maynard Massachusetts (MA) Indian Restaurants Maynard Massachusetts (MA) Indian Restaurants Maynard Indian Restaurants in Maynard Indian Restaurants Maynard Massachusetts MA
Updated on: November 2024